Chapter 41
"You really have a way with words, don't you? But do you honestly think all this talking masks your true intentions?"
"And how about you, what exactly are you hiding?"
Amara stared at Liliana, her gaze piercing, as if she could see right through Liliana's facade. "What are you implying?" Liliana asked, a hint of discomfort flickered across her face.
"Just what I said. You keep coming at me, picking fights. Are you insecure about your relationship with Finnian? Afraid he might not be as into you as you claim? You parade around the set, flaunting how much Finnian adores you. Is that just to cover up the possibility he might not care as much as you want everyone to believe?"
Liliana became silent and her expression shifted eventually, a flicker of anger igniting behind her eyes, her expression grim, seemingly intimidating. Yet, she quickly regained her composure, slipping back into her confident demeanor.
Amara had to admire her emotional control, despite the tension.
"Finn treats me wonderfully, and everyone can see how much he cares. I don't need to hide anything," Liliana said dismissively.
"Assuming maliciously Finn's affection for me, you're just bitter and jealous, so pathetic."
Her jab stung Amara. It wasn't about being bitter and jealous, but her life indeed had been one struggle after another. She clenched her fists tight.
"Watch your words, Liliana," she warned with each word emphasized. "You can eat whatever you like, but you can't just say whatever you want. You'll have to answer for what you say."
"Ha."
Liliana seemingly found Amara's words laughable, flipping her hair over her shoulder as she sauntered off with her usual grace.
Amara sank down to the ground slowly, thinking about the conversation. She had only meant to rile Liliana up, but deep down, she knew Finnian truly cared for Liliana. She had seen Finnian defend Liliana in front of Kevin; he must be head over heels.
She wasn't so confident while making the comments. And Liliana's quick recovery only confirmed it; she must've had all the assurance she needed from Finnian's affection, leading to her dismissal of others' sabotage.
Amara pressed a hand to her chest, feeling a sharp pang.
Later that evening, as the crew wrapped up filming, Liliana passed by Amara, whispering, "You'll pay for those reckless words you threw at me today."
Amara didn't understand what she meant. Exhausted from the day's work, she didn't give it much thought and headed home.
The next morning, she was jolted awake by a barrage of calls from Elysia and Keith. It seemed something major had unfolded overnight.
Twitter was ablaze with a sensational article claiming to have "reliable sources". The piece alleged that the Whispers of Winter production had more drama behind the scenes than on screen. Supposedly, the show's biggest investor and its scriptwriter were secretly married, but it was a marriage of convenience, not love, and now they were divorcing.
In the middle of this, the mysterious investor was rumored to be romancing the show's leading actress. But make no mistake—Liliana wasn't the "other woman" because the investor and scriptwriter were reportedly bound by a mere contract.
